Original Description
George Inness's Summer Days, Cattle Drinking (Late Summer, Early Autumn) (1873) is a sublime example of American tonalism, capturing the poetic transition between seasons with muted, atmospheric tones. The painting depicts cattle leisurely drinking by a tranquil pond, enveloped in a golden haze that blurs the boundaries between land, water, and sky. Inness masterfully conveys serenity through soft brushstrokes and a harmonious palette of warm ochres, dusky greens, and ethereal blues. Rooted in the Barbizon School’s influence, he rejected strict realism, favoring emotional resonance—an approach that positioned him as a precursor to modern landscape painting. This work embodies his belief that art should evoke spiritual contemplation rather than mere visual representation, securing his legacy as a pivotal figure in 19th-century American art. Its meditative quality reflects the Hudson River School’s reverence for nature while foreshadowing impressionistic abstraction.
